In the United States and lots of various other countries, a dietitian is a board-certified food and nourishment professional. They are extremely educated in the field of nourishment and dietetics the scientific research of food, nutrition, and their effect on human health. With comprehensive training, dietitians obtain the know-how to give evidence-based clinical nutrition therapy and dietary therapy tailored to fulfill a person's demands.
-1To make these qualifications dietitians-to-be must first make a bachelor's level or equivalent debts from a certified program at an university or university. Commonly, this calls for an undergraduate science level, consisting of courses in biology, microbiology, organic and not natural chemistry, biochemistry, composition, and physiology, as well as more specific nourishment coursework.

In numerous states, such as Alaska, Florida, Illinois, Maryland, Massachusetts, and Pennsylvania, RDs and CNSs are provided the very same state permit, typically called a Certified Dietitian Nutritional Expert (LDN) certificate. In states that don't manage using this term, any person with a passion in diet plan or nutrition may call themselves a nutritional expert.
-1However, because uncredentialed nutritional experts commonly lack the proficiency and training for medical nourishment treatment and nourishment therapy, following their guidance could be taken into consideration damaging (). Before getting in touch with a nutritionist, you might desire to check whether your state controls that might utilize this title. In the U.S. states that don't manage the term, no levels or credentials are required to be a nutritional expert.
In states that do mandate licensure, the CNS or RD credential might called for. Those with CNS qualifications are health and wellness specialists like nurses or medical professionals with innovative health levels that have actually looked for additional coursework, completed supervised method hours, and passed an exam managed by the Board for Accreditation of Nourishment Specialists.

Dietitians typically function with more clinically sensitive clients. Due to the fact that of the high level of knowledge called for to offer services to these people, only recognized dietitians are permitted to provide treatment.
-1In Australia there is a difference between a dietitian and various other dietary health suppliers consisting of nutritional experts. All dietitians are nutritional experts, however nutritional experts without a dietetics qualification can not call themselves a dietitian.
-1Dietitians with the Accredited Practising Dietitian (APD) credential dedicate to continuous training and education throughout their professions. As a career, nutritionists are not managed in Australia under NASRHP or certified under a solitary regulatory body.
If you have a chronic health and wellness problem and a treatment plan from your General practitioner, you may be able to assert a Medicare rebate when you see an APD.
